What is the total resistance three resistances of 4 ohm, 6 ohms and 8 ohm respectively are connected in parallel? Give the solution

Answer :

Three identical resistors of resistances 4Ω, 6Ω and 8Ω are connected in parallel.

We have to find equivalent resistance of the connection.

Equivalent resistance of parallel connection is given by

1/R = 1/R1 + 1/R2 + ... + 1/Rn

Let's calculate

➝ 1/R = 1/R1 + 1/R2 + 1/R3

➝ 1/R = 1/4 + 1/6 + 1/8

➝ 1/R = (6 + 4 + 3) / 24

➝ R = 24/13

R = 1.85Ω

Learn More :

Equivalent resistance of series connection is given by

R = R1 + R2 + ... + Rn
